Device variants:
lpc1100
lpc1102
lpc1104
lpc1111
lpc1112
lpc1113
lpc1114
lpc1115
The ARM® Cortex™-M0 processor is the smallest, lowest-power and most energy-efficient ARM processor available. The exceptionally small silicon area, low power, and minimal code footprint of the processor achieves 32-bit performance at an 8-bit price point, bypassing the step to 16-bit devices.
The Cortex-M0 processor promises substantial savings in system cost while retaining tool and binary compatibility with feature-rich processors such as the Cortex-M3 processor. It consumes as little as 85 microwatts/MHz (0.085 milliwatts) in an area of typically under 12K gates, enabling the creation of ultra low-power analog and mixed signal devices.
Key Features and Benefits
The ARM Cortex-M0 processor offers significant benefits to system and software developers:
- 32-bit performance in a 16-bit footprint resulting in more power efficiency and longer battery life, plus performance headroom for product enhancements
- Small size enables the processor and analog circuits to be implemented on single die
- Lower cost devices through a smaller processing core, system and memories
- Ultra-low power consumption and integrated sleep modes resulting in longer battery life
- Thumb® instruction set for maximum code density
- Fast interrupt handling for critical control applications
- Wake-up Interrupt Controller enables ultra-low leakage retention mode with instantaneous, fully-active mode for critical events
- Enhanced system debug for faster development
- 100% C-coding including interrupt handlers and boot code to ease system development; Zero assembler code required
- Wide application envelope encompassing ultra-low cost microcontrollers and analog mixed signal applications

